How Coil Tempering Influences Long-Term Elasticity

The durability of a spring mattress is closely linked to the heat-treating process used on its coils. High-carbon steel springs undergo tempering to stabilize their molecular structure, which helps them retain their tension even after thousands of compression cycles. When coils are consistently tempered, they resist metal fatigue more effectively, reducing the risk of sagging over time. Differences Between Coil Designs and Their Lifespan Impact

Spring structure design significantly influences how well a mattress maintains its support. Pocket springs, for instance, work independently and experience less cumulative stress than interconnected spring units. Bonnell springs distribute impact through a larger network, but require stronger steel to maintain shape. Zoned coil systems provide targeted reinforcement in areas that bear high pressure, preventing premature deformation. Understanding these distinctions helps identify which spring configuration is best suited for long-term durability.

Load Distribution and Its Influence on Spring Stability

Spring fatigue often occurs in mattresses where pressure repeatedly concentrates in the same regions. When coil layouts distribute weight more evenly, each spring undergoes less stress, extending its operational elasticity. Edge-reinforced designs also contribute to longevity by stabilizing the perimeter, reducing collapse and long-term sinking. These features are especially useful for users who frequently sit on the sides of the bed or place high pressure on one area throughout the night.

Material Quality and Surface Treatments for Enhanced Resilience

Coil materials vary widely, and their quality directly affects long-term elasticity. High-carbon steel offers superior tensile strength, while additional treatments such as anti-corrosion coating protect coils from humidity-related degradation. Humidity fluctuations can cause micro-corrosion, weakening spring tension over time. Evaluating Compression Resistance Over Extended Use

Compression resistance testing measures how springs behave under repeated load cycles. Industry laboratories simulate years of use by applying thousands of compressions to determine whether coils retain their height, tension, and rebound speed. Mattresses with stronger coil gauges typically outperform lighter-gauge coils in these tests. The table below provides a simplified comparison of performance characteristics related to different coil gauges.

Coil Gauge Compression Resistance Elasticity Retention
Thicker Gauge High Excellent
Medium Gauge Moderate Good
Thinner Gauge Lower Fair

The Role of Insulation Layers in Preventing Spring Wear

Insulation layers positioned above the spring unit serve as a buffer that reduces friction between coils and cushioning materials. Without proper insulation, repeated movements can cause fabric abrasion or foam indentation, indirectly impacting the spring structure beneath. High-density felt or reinforced non-woven layers help distribute load to minimize localized spring stress. This design consideration is key in preserving coil alignment and maintaining mattress support even after extended usage.

Environmental Factors Affecting Spring Longevity

Temperature shifts, humidity changes, and poor ventilation can gradually affect spring stability. Steel expands and contracts with temperature variations, and in poorly ventilated rooms, trapped moisture may accelerate oxidation. Placing the mattress on a breathable frame prevents moisture buildup and helps preserve coil integrity. Maintenance Habits That Extend Spring Mattress Performance

Proper user habits contribute significantly to keeping spring mattresses supportive over time. Rotating the mattress helps equalize pressure distribution, preventing certain coils from wearing faster than others. Using a stable bed frame reduces flexing in unsupported zones, which in turn preserves spring tension. Keeping the mattress in a dry, ventilated environment also supports the longevity of the coils and reduces risk of structural fatigue.
